1. III-V Nanowire Array Solar Cells: Optical and Electrical Modelling
Sammanfattning : This thesis describes optical and electrical modelling of vertically oriented III-V semiconductor nanowire array solar cells (NWASCs).In the optical studies, three-dimensional electromagnetic modelling was carried out with the scattering matrix method and the finite element method. 2. Novel cycles using carbon dioxide as working fluid : new ways to utilize energy from low-grade heat sources
Sammanfattning : This licentiate thesis proposes and analyzes three carbon dioxide novel cycles, namely: the carbon dioxide transcritical power cycle, the carbon dioxide Brayton cycle and the carbon dioxide cooling and power combined cycle. 3. Structural and Biochemical Studies of Antibiotic Resistance and Ribosomal Frameshifting
Sammanfattning : Protein synthesis, translation, performed by the ribosome, is a fundamental process of life and one of the main targets of antibacterial drugs. 5. Cyber-Physical Engineering of Distributed Automation Systems in Energy Domain
Sammanfattning : The main focus of this thesis is in the domain of Energy Systems, specifically in the engi-neering of modern Smart Grid (SG) automation systems. The SG has been categorizedas a Cyber-Physical System (CPS), a complex system which exhibits tight integration between the cyber and the physical processes and their interactions in a networked envi-ronment.
